Pay in context

Top pay as a share of expenses

In 2023, the highest total compensation at University of Arizona Foundation equaled 0.3% of the organization's total expenses. The median for education organizations is 7%.

This organization (2023)
0.3%
Sector median
7%
Middle half of sector
2% to 17%

Based on 26,320 education organizations, each measured at its most recent filing year with reported expenses and compensation.

FAQ

Common questions about University of Arizona Foundation

What does the Chief Executive Officer of University of Arizona Foundation earn?

In 2023, the Chief Executive Officer of University of Arizona Foundation received $546,829 in total compensation. This pay is in the top 10% for Chief Executive Officer roles among Education organizations in Arizona: at least 9 in 10 comparable filings report less. Based on IRS Form 990 data.

How does Chief Executive Officer pay at University of Arizona Foundation compare with similar nonprofits?

Compared with the same role at Education organizations in Arizona, the 2023 pay of the Chief Executive Officer at University of Arizona Foundation falls in the top 10%. In 2023, the highest total compensation at University of Arizona Foundation equaled 0.3% of the organization's total expenses. The median for education organizations is 7%.

What are University of Arizona Foundation's revenue and expenses?

In 2023, University of Arizona Foundation reported $224.6M in total revenue and $168.5M in total expenses on its IRS Form 990.
